English: Used by the Brothers in the processions of Holy Week, the procession staffs are, besides the Crucifix, the seven instruments of the Passion. This object is classé Monument Historique in the base Palissy, database of the French furniture patrimony of the French ministry of culture, under the reference PM43000168.
